    Well if you have a computer or something that has 1 GHz CPU, 1 GB of RAM, 128 MB of graphic memory, and 20GB+ of Hard drive space, you can actually download it from the Microsoft website. I always encourage though to have above minimum specs. If you have 2GB of RAM you will be sailing.

    Another word of advice... DON'T UPGRADE IT FROM XP OR VISTA. It only lasts till August 1, 2008. Make a separate partition and install Windows 7 on the new partition.

    I only had BSOD when I was trying to use my FW port. It was driving me nuts. I learned I had to change the driver in order to get it to work properly. i haven't had any issues after that (YET).

    If you haven't done so, make sure you get the latest drivers for you computer for W7. Since it is based on Vista you can just download them to make it work (presumingly). Also don't forget, at the end of the day... it is a Beta and it should be considered unstable.
